On Wed, May 15, 2002 at 03:16:29PM -0700, Matthew Dharm wrote:

> Could someone give me an overview of how you're supposed to do a
> handoff between a 32-bit loader and a 64-bit app?  I'm guessing there
> has to be a way to do it, but what I do know about the 64-bit stuff
> doesn't show me how this is accomplished (I have visions of UX bits
> floating in my head...)

If you're placing the kernel in KSEG0 like all other current targets are
doing then your 32-bit pointers are valid 64-bit pointers, no magic,
no thinking necessary.
